What is Grade 1045?

Grade 1045 is a medium carbon steel used for mechanical parts. This 1045 tube gets its additional strength from quenching and tempering. It still has good machinability when annealed. Because the carbon stays between 0.43-0.50%, the metal gets much harder during heat treatment. This makes it a great choice for parts that need to resist wear and stay strong.

ASTM A519 Grade 1045 Tube Chemical Composition

The table below shows the chemical composition of SAE 1045 steel per ASTM A519.

Element Carbon (C) Manganese (Mn) Phosphorus (P) Sulfur (S) Silicon (Si) Iron (Fe)
Content (%) 0.43 – 0.50 0.60 – 0.90 0.040 max 0.050 max 0.15 – 0.35 Balance

ASTM A519 Grade 1045 Tube Mechanical Properties

These are the mechanical properties of 1045 steel tube that include the tensile strength, yield strength, and other factors.

Property Value
Tensile Strength 620 – 760 MPa
Yield Strength 330 MPa (min)
Elongation 16% (min)
Hardness 170 – 210 HB

ASTM A519 Grade 1045 Tube Equivalent Designation

Check these Grade 1045 equivalents for international standards, where the UNS is G10450, DIN is 1.0503, and so on.

Standard UNS SAE AISI JIS EN
Grade G10450 1045 1045 S45C C45E / C45R

Applications

The 1045 tubing serves 2 demanding mechanical applications requiring heat treatment:

Shafts and Spindles

Rotating machinery components including drive shafts, machine spindles, and motor shafts benefit from the high strength achievable through heat treatment of 1045 seamless tubing.

Gears

Non-carburised gear applications use 1045 carbon steel tubing for through-hardened gears where the entire cross-section requires uniform hardness and strength.
